Webbetter decision-making; or . e) decisions about whether judicial review under the . Judicial Review Act 1991 should apply. Judicial and merit review processes are different. Merit review involves standing in the shoes of the original decision maker, reconsidering the facts, law and policy aspects of the original decision. To say it simply, it is the process of … WebMerit-based regulation assumes that the market regulators are better informed than investors and can better decide the merits of transactions on their behalf. These merit judgment is the indication of whether the companies can provide safe securities in making business in order to protect the investment made by the investor.
